The Engineering Leaders of Tomorrow Program (LOT) is a comprehensive curricular, co-curricular, extra-curricular leadership development initiative for engineering students. LOT envisions: “an engineering education that is a life-long foundation for transformational leaders and outstanding citizens.” Academic courses, co-curricular certificate programs, departmental programs, and stand alone workshops emphasize four domains of leadership: Self, Relational, Organizational, and Societal Leadership. This article introduces the 14 week summer leadership initiative for research students in the Department of Chemical Engineering and Applied Chemistry. Students gather on Friday afternoons from early May to late August to learn and practice leadership. Based on student assessment data, the program is having positive impact.
